After completing a study with partner Cushman & Wakefield, BCG
decided to relocate their office from Bethesda, MD to Washington,
DC. BCG worked closely with Gensler to establish program
requirements for the new space and enlisted Price Modern to support
the procurement of new furnishings. As part of their relocation, BCG
sought to incorporate more meeting and collaborative spaces to
better support how staff work. Gensler’s design balanced the need
for function with a residential aesthetic, utilizing a variety of colors
and textures to create a welcoming environment.
The Price Modern teamed collaborated with BCG, Gensler, Haworth,
and 45+ manufacturers to create custom furniture solutions
throughout the entire space. This included conference rooms, team
rooms, lounge areas, café seating, focus rooms, and much more. We
coordinated with the entire team to customize virtually every piece of
furniture in the new workplace, ensuring BCG’s vision was brought to
life. Private offices and workstations were also customized, requiring
our team to work hand-in-hand with the general contractor to
ensure power was placed correctly throughout each floor. Though
the project timeline was challenged by delays in manufacturing,
our team communicated regularly to track all furniture and ensure
products were delivered as quickly as possible. The result is a
stunning workplace set to inspire staff to do their best work.
This project won the NAIOP DC|MD Award of Exellence, Best Interiors
– Over 75,000 SF and Interior Design Magazine’s 2023 Best of Year,
Extra Large Corporate Office
